What To Do To Avoid Water Leaks?

In addition to the bill and waste impacts, water leakage can cause problems in your property’s structure, affecting walls, floors, and pipes. And there is an aggravating factor: it is not always visible, so it is essential to pay attention so that it can be identified as soon as possible. Here is what to do to avoid water leakage in your home.

More important than knowing what to do in case of a leak is to understand how to avoid them; after all, prevention is better than cure, right? For this, make frequent inspections in the rooms of the house, taps, flushes, etc.

Check that the plumbing is well sealed, that the toilet and taps are not dripping after use, that the water tank is in perfect condition, etc. In the case of flushing, it is sometimes possible to hear the sound of running water or the coupled box filling frequently, even without being triggered. If you notice any of these problems, scrutinize the site.

It is also necessary to pay extra attention when drilling walls to install cabinets, shelves, and pictures. Remember that the pipes in your house go through the walls, so there is a risk that they will be drilled right now. If this happens, close the water valve quickly so that the leak stops and call a professional to change the piping.
